resolution
minimum distance between 2 objects in which they can still be viewed as separate
magnification
how many times larger the image is compared to the object

eye piece graticule
used to measure the size of objects you are viewing under the microscope
magnification calculation
magnification = size of image/size of real object
differential staining
many chemical stains used to stain different parts of a cell in different colours
